Agility is the governing Attribute for Block, Light Armor, Marksman, and Sneak. It affects:

  • Your ability to successfully hit enemies with a weapon and dodge their attacks (not magic).
  • Your ability to use the Sneak (including pickpocketing), Security and Block skills. Note - this is not the same as skills 'governed' by Agility - those skills simply provide bonuses to raising Agility when leveling up, and are not themselves necessarily enhanced by the character's Agility.
  • Your maximum Fatigue.
  • Your resistance against staggering.

Character Creation[edit]

The starting values for Agility vary by race and gender:

Race M F Race M F
Argonian 50 40 Khajiit 50 50
Breton 30 30 Nord 30 30
Dark Elf 40 40 Orc 35 35
High Elf 40 40 Redguard 40 40
Imperial 30 30 Wood Elf 50 50

Note[edit]

  • Since Agility affects the resistance against staggering, using the Berserk power of Orcs which decreases Agility by 100 points for 60 seconds will cause the user to fall when struck even with maxed Agility.
